Henry Jameson
e5ae0671ce
skip user profile test for now https://github.com/vuejs/test-utils/issues/1382
3 years ago
Henry Jameson
9d7a7e2019
fix emoji input tests
3 years ago
Henry Jameson
c2cf13fc00
fix richcontent and its tests
3 years ago
Henry Jameson
c3546ea856
fix tests running
3 years ago
HJ
58d0f9678b
Merge branch 'fix-mentions-new-bugs' into 'develop'
...
Fix newfound bugs with rich mentions + user suggestions
See merge request pleroma/pleroma-fe!1430
3 years ago
Henry Jameson
5864dc52f7
removed file because that logic has been removed
3 years ago
Henry Jameson
86e3aefdab
new unit tests
3 years ago
Henry Jameson
a8d1987686
fix unit tests
3 years ago
Henry Jameson
39494439d3
very minimalist hashtaglink implementation, also you can middle-click
...
mentions now.
3 years ago
Henry Jameson
c3576211cb
fix tests
3 years ago
Henry Jameson
8cc1ad67df
fix links sticking to mentionsline
3 years ago
Henry Jameson
7d67e8f1cc
remove obsolete tests
3 years ago
Henry Jameson
97e86381c8
remove old emoji added, everything emoji-bearing uses RichContent now
3 years ago
Henry Jameson
add5921b8b
fix tests, add performance test (skipped, doesn't assert anything),
...
tweak max mentions count
3 years ago
Henry Jameson
2cfff1b8b9
remove new options for style and separate line, now groups all chained
...
mentions on a mentionsline regardless of placement. fixes spacing
3 years ago
Henry Jameson
a0eaac2216
fix tests
3 years ago
Henry Jameson
c6831a3810
fix not escaping some stuff
3 years ago
Henry Jameson
8fe4355a6b
fix rich images
3 years ago
Henry Jameson
25bf28f051
added tests just in case
3 years ago
Henry Jameson
ad3a2fd4e5
fixed "invisible" spans inside links
3 years ago
Henry Jameson
4aac0125e5
fixed bug with hashtags
3 years ago
Henry Jameson
7309f8ce1a
lint
3 years ago
Henry Jameson
c21b1cf898
do the impossible, fix the unfixable
3 years ago
Henry Jameson
636dbdaba8
more fixes
3 years ago
Henry Jameson
bebafa1a2c
refactored line converter, untied its logic from greentexting, better
...
handling of broken cases
3 years ago
Henry Jameson
9c70f3e4df
fixed a bug + made a testcase out of it
3 years ago
Henry Jameson
18fb7516cc
lint
3 years ago
Henry Jameson
418f029789
review + fixes
3 years ago
Henry Jameson
90a188f2c3
cleanup
3 years ago
Henry Jameson
cd44556750
restructure and tests
...
squash! restructure and tests
3 years ago
Henry Jameson
5834790d0b
fix #935
3 years ago
Henry Jameson
cc00af7a31
Hellthread(tm) Certified
3 years ago
Henry Jameson
b0ae32e309
made getAttrs correctly handle both ' and "
3 years ago
Henry Jameson
1923ed84d4
more tests
3 years ago
Henry Jameson
be79643bcf
fix emoji processor not leaving string as-is if no emoji are found
3 years ago
Henry Jameson
20ce646852
[WIP] MUCH better approach to replacing emojis with still versions
3 years ago
Shpuld Shpuldson
49aa10e1c0
add screen_name_ui to tests
4 years ago
Shpuld Shpuldson
09fe160e8b
separate screen_name and screen_name_ui with decoded punycode
4 years ago
Shpuld Shpuldson
7834ff52b1
add test
4 years ago
Shpuld Shpludson
ef6e2087ae
fix #1036 convert screen name to unicode with punycode
4 years ago
Shpuld Shpuldson
1d2ba946b6
make notifications also use the popup errors, remove all error from status/notif state
4 years ago
Shpuld Shpuldson
757706425a
fix test
4 years ago
eugenijm
e798e9a417
Optimistic message sending for chat
4 years ago
eugenijm
8c4514013d
Fix chat messages being missed when the streaming is disabled and the messages are sent by both participants simultaneously
4 years ago
Shpuld Shpuldson
0347d79bda
Rewrite word split imperatively for control
4 years ago
Shpuld Shpuldson
a0c17e1fd0
fix tests by removing only and adding empty func for notification tests
4 years ago
eugenijm
f05f832bff
Address feedback
...
Use more specific css rules for the emoji dimensions in the chat list status preview.
Use more round em value for chat list item height.
Add global html overflow and height for smoother chat navigation in
the desktop Safari.
Use offsetHeight instad of a computed style when setting the window height on resize.
Remove margin-bottom from the last message to avoid occasional layout shift in the desktop Safari
Use break-word to prevent chat message text overflow
Resize and scroll the textarea when inserting a new line on ctrl+enter
Remove fade transition on route change
Ensure proper border radius at the bottom of the chat, remove unused border-radius
Prevent the chat header "jumping" on the avatar load.
4 years ago
eugenijm
aa2cf51c05
Add Chats
4 years ago
Eugenij
de291e2e33
Add bookmarks
...
Co-authored-by: jared <jaredrmain@gmail.com>
4 years ago
Shpuld Shpludson
ea0a12f604
Merge branch 'develop' into 'iss-149/profile-fields-setting'
...
# Conflicts:
# src/components/settings_modal/tabs/profile_tab.vue
4 years ago
Shpuld Shpuldson
f8cf92a01f
Merge branch 'develop' into kPherox/pleroma-fe-iss-149/profile-fields-display
4 years ago
lain
8d7d4980b9
StatusParser: Remove unused removeAttachmentLinks.
...
Brings down the vendor by over 200kb
4 years ago
kPherox
cc4691a4ef
Fix merging array field for users
4 years ago
lain
05167f202f
EntityNormalizerSpec: More fixes.
4 years ago
lain
c2dfe1f6cc
EntityNormalizerSpec: Test new behavior.
4 years ago
Shpuld Shpuldson
af9492977a
add back mute prediction, add getter for relationships
4 years ago
Shpuld Shpuldson
cda298c822
remove unused mutation and test for it
4 years ago
Shpuld Shpuldson
576ad9750b
make tests not fail
4 years ago
kPherox
da55b0d435
Add fields_text for tooltip
5 years ago
HJ
3ddf7ebe2c
Merge branch 'themes-accent' into 'develop'
...
Themes v3 Part 1 "2.1" codenamed "One step for themes, a giant burder for code reviewers"
Closes #750 and #774
See merge request pleroma/pleroma-fe!1037
5 years ago
HJ
12cd96bfa7
Merge branch 'fix-android-emoji-input' into 'develop'
...
Add onInput() function as listener for input events, remove unnecessary compositionupdate listener
Closes #775
See merge request pleroma/pleroma-fe!1065
5 years ago
xenofem
c1e38a4423
EmojiInput tests should be checking the input value on the last input event, not the first
5 years ago
HJ
84ebae8ed3
Merge branch 'develop' into 'themes-accent'
...
# Conflicts:
# src/components/emoji_reactions/emoji_reactions.vue
5 years ago
Shpuld Shpludson
f6b482be51
Emoji Reactions - fixes and improvements
5 years ago
Henry Jameson
f0c4bb1193
Merge remote-tracking branch 'upstream/develop' into themes-accent
...
* upstream/develop: (33 commits)
add emoji reactions to changelog
fix emoji reaction classes broken in develop
review changes
Fix password and email update
remove unnecessary anonymous function
Apply suggestion to src/services/api/api.service.js
remove logs/commented code
remove favs count from react button
remove mock data
change emoji reactions to use new format
Added polyfills for EventTarget (needed for Safari) and CustomEvent (needed for IE)
Fix missing TWKN when logged in, but server is set to private mode.
Fix follower request fetching
Add domain mutes to changelog
Implement domain mutes v2
change changelog to reflect actual release history of frontend
Fix #750 , fix error messages and captcha resetting
Optimize Notifications Rendering
update CHANGELOG
Use last seen notif instead of first unseen notif for sinceId
...
5 years ago
Henry Jameson
5313833d80
lint
5 years ago
Henry Jameson
7c074b8741
fix rgba css generation, add some tests to automatically verify that themes are
...
generated properly
5 years ago
Shpuld Shpuldson
c4beac5f89
Merge branch 'develop' into feat/emoji-reactions
5 years ago
Shpuld Shpuldson
a018ea622c
change emoji reactions to use new format
5 years ago
Henry Jameson
2b36a62c56
fix tests, integrate depenentless sorting into toposort for easier testing and
...
better guarantees
5 years ago
Shpuld Shpludson
86380f0429
Optimize Notifications Rendering
5 years ago
Henry Jameson
21d9c87b34
fix tests
5 years ago
Henry Jameson
622c9d388e
Refactoring, forgotten files
5 years ago
seven
cb92865dac
upgrade babel-register
5 years ago
taehoon
d37caeeded
add html-webpack-plugin to karma config
5 years ago
HJ
0eda60eeb4
Merge branch 'greentext-strikes-back' into 'develop'
...
⑨ Added greentext support ⑨
Closes #9
See merge request pleroma/pleroma-fe!994
5 years ago
kPherox
a55486f8d7
Normalize profile fields
5 years ago
Henry Jameson
bd2a682b83
tests + updates
5 years ago
Henry Jameson
b66564a30d
Merge remote-tracking branch 'upstream/develop' into settings-refactor
...
* upstream/develop: (89 commits)
remove needless ref
show preview popover when hover numbered replies
refactor conditions
do not make too many nested div
add fetchStatus action
refactor status loading logic
split status preview popover into a separate component
uninstall mobile-detect library
listen both events
minor css fix
restrict distance at top side only
set different trigger event in desktop and mobile by default
fix eslint warnings
fix popper go behind the top bar
migrate Popper to v-popover
fix popper go behind the top bar
fix eslint warnings
reset font-size to normal text size using rem
use top placement by default
hide status preview popper when hover popper content
...
5 years ago
Henry Jameson
0be86304d2
Fix tests, more replacing with mergedConfig
5 years ago
Henry Jameson
a2923570c3
fix regex shortcode problem
5 years ago
kaniini
4369ce6f1b
Merge branch 'hide-followers-follows-count' into 'develop'
...
Added a setting to hide follow/follower count from the user profile
See merge request pleroma/pleroma-fe!951
5 years ago
Henry Jameson
836cb817d1
fix tests
5 years ago
Henry Jameson
7b4cb38734
split spam mode into two separate options (one in settings page)
5 years ago
eugenijm
aafb29c589
Added a setting to hide follow/follower count from the user profile
5 years ago
Henry Jameson
db961af3c8
unit test for emoji input, for now covering only insertion mechanism
5 years ago
Henry Jameson
0d8b68632b
Remove emoji zoom
5 years ago
Henry Jameson
9146bee7aa
better hitbox for status emoji
5 years ago
taehoon
18a41e785e
update unit test
5 years ago
taehoon
d785ed5a05
rewrite unit tests
5 years ago
taehoon
a443a5203e
add more unit tests for elimination logic
5 years ago
taehoon
65ef039316
add unit test for elimination logic
5 years ago
Shpuld Shpludson
54b0f90133
Merge branch 'eslint-fix' into 'develop'
...
Fix shitton warning eslint gives
See merge request pleroma/pleroma-fe!871
5 years ago
Shpuld Shpludson
c8794b2b84
Merge branch '580' into 'develop'
...
Fix backend version string parsing
Closes #580
See merge request pleroma/pleroma-fe!868
5 years ago
Eugenij
14ec12b4f6
Set hide_follows and hide_followers settings when parsing Mastodon format
5 years ago
Henry Jameson
020c6d1bcf
all the manual fixes
5 years ago
HJ
8f53796420
Merge branch 'develop' into 'eslint-fix'
...
# Conflicts:
# src/components/post_status_form/post_status_form.vue
5 years ago
taehoon
c712754150
add unit tests
5 years ago
Henry Jameson
2c2b84d31d
npm eslint --fix .
5 years ago
taehoon
d8e210df4d
update test for clearTimeline action
5 years ago